Some of the IP cores that are included in Xilinx EDK require an extra license before they can be used. In the "IP Catalog" windows these cores are tagged with a special symbol, a padlock. Usually, an evaluation license is provide with these cores, so they can be implemented and tested. However, this licenses will expire some months after the release of the EDK version. So, if Your EDK version is too old, all Your evaluation licenses have expired. As far as I know, new eval. licenses can be requested via the Xilinx website.
